Mrs John H. Connell

This portrait painting shows Mrs John H. Connell, seated from a side on angle, wearing a grey, patterned gown, holding a fan. Date: circa 1918

EDITORS COMMENTS
Mrs. John H. Connell: A Vision of Elegance from the Early Twentieth Century This evocative portrait painting captures the refined beauty and grace of Mrs. John H. Connell, seated from a side angle, circa 1918. The oil on canvas work, created by the renowned Australian artist Longstaff, showcases Mrs. Connell's timeless elegance as she dons a stylish grey, patterned gown. The intricate design of the fabric adds texture and depth to the painting, while the delicate folds of the garment accentuate her slender figure. Mrs. Connell's poised demeanor is further enhanced by her elegant posture and the dainty fan she holds in her right hand. The fan, a symbol of femininity and refinement, adds an air of sophistication to the image. The subtle expression on her face exudes an air of quiet confidence and composure, making for a truly captivating portrait. The painting is part of the prestigious March of the Women Collection, housed at the National Gallery of Victoria in Melbourne, Australia. This collection is renowned for its significant representation of Australian women's history and culture. The inclusion of this portrait in the collection underscores the importance of preserving the stories and images of women from the past, allowing future generations to appreciate their contributions and influences.
